As a policy, reporters will not make use of a lengthy word when a short one will do. News writers try to prevent using the same word much more than as soon as in a paragraph (occasionally called an "resemble" or "word mirror").


Headlines often omit the topic (e.g., "Leaps From Watercraft, Catches in Wheel") or verb (e.g., "Feline lady fortunate"). A subhead (additionally subhed, sub-headline, subheading, caption, deck or dek) can be either a subservient title under the primary headline, or the heading of a subsection of the short article. It is a heading that precedes the main message, or a group of paragraphs of the main text.

Article leads are sometimes classified into difficult leads and soft leads. A difficult lead intends to supply a detailed thesis which informs the viewers what the write-up will certainly cover.


Instance of a hard-lead paragraph NASA is recommending an additional area task. The spending plan demands about $10 billion for the task.


The NASA news came as the agency requested $10 billion of appropriations for the project. An "off-lead" is the 2nd essential front web page news of the day. The off-lead shows up either in the leading left edge, or directly listed below the lead on the right. To "hide the lead" is to start the short article with background info or details of secondary importance to the visitors, requiring them to review even more deeply into an article than they need to have to in order to discover the crucial factors.

Typical usage is that one or 2 sentences each develop their very own paragraph. Reporters generally define the organization or structure of an information story as an inverted pyramid. The essential and most interesting components of a story are put at the beginning, with sustaining information complying with in order of diminishing significance.


It permits people to check out a topic to just the deepness that their inquisitiveness takes them, and without the imposition of details or nuances that they might consider unimportant, however still making that info offered to extra interested viewers. The upside down pyramid structure likewise makes it possible for articles to be trimmed to any type of arbitrary size during format, to suit the space readily available.


Some authors start their stories with the "1-2-3 lead", yet there are lots of type of lead readily available. This format usually begins with a "Five Ws" opening up paragraph (as explained above), followed by an indirect quote that offers to sustain a significant element of the initial paragraph, and after that a straight quote to sustain the indirect quote.
